Text

A person is entitled to receive a cosmetologist license if the person does all of the following: 1. Submits to the board an application for a cosmetologist license on a form supplied by the board. 2. Does either of the following:

(a)Completes and receives appropriate credits for at least two years of high school education or its equivalent as prescribed by the board in its rules and submits satisfactory evidence that the person is at least sixteen years of age.
(b)Submits to the board satisfactory evidence that the person is at least eighteen years of age. 3. Submits to the board satisfactory evidence of any of the following:
(a)That the person is a graduate of a cosmetology course consisting of at least one thousand five hundred hours of training in a school licensed by the board
